Makeup tips for mature skin

Makeup application for mature skin requires specific techniques to enhance natural beauty while minimizing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. One essential tip from makeup artists is to always use a damp sponge when applying foundation.

The hydration provided by the damp sponge ensures a smooth application, preventing the makeup from settling into wrinkles. Unlike a makeup brush, which may glide product over the skin, a damp sponge seamlessly blends the foundation, delivering a flawless and long-lasting finish. To incorporate this technique, wet the sponge, gently squeeze out excess water, and lightly press it into the foundation, then bounce it across the face for an even application.

Defining your brows plays a crucial role in framing your face and adding structure. Using a brow pencil and gel, gradually build a naturally-defined brow that complements your features. Avoid going too dark, as an overly pronounced brow can appear severe. Take your time during the process, stepping back to assess and add more as needed. For a polished look, set your brows in place with a clear brow gel.

Highlighter can be a game-changer for mature skin, creating dimension and a youthful glow. Opt for a clear, moisturizing highlighter to avoid emphasizing fine lines and wrinkles.

Apply a small amount using a makeup sponge or fingertips, focusing on the tops of your cheekbones where natural light reflects. Steer clear of glittery or sparkly highlighters, as they may accentuate imperfections. This subtle highlighting technique adds a natural radiance to your overall look while saving you money on unnecessary products.
